Popped and poured; enjoyed over the course of a couple hours. This bottle of the 2005 Gran Reserva came from a Library Release in 2022 so the cork was perfect. The wine pours a garnet color with a translucent core; medium+ viscosity with light staining of the tears. On the nose, the wine is developing with notes of tart, ripe and some dried, mostly red fruits: Bing cherry, raspberries, plum, tobacco, leather, dill and assorted dried garden herbs, gentle baking spices and dry, dusty earth. On the palate, the wine is dry with medium+ tannin and medium+ acid. Confirming the notes from the nose. The finish is long. This is in a lovely spot and yet, has a long life ahead. Drink now with some patience and enjoy through 2045. — 3 months ago

Popped and poured; enjoyed over the course of an hour. The 2001 Reserva pours a deep ruby/purple color with an opaque core; medium viscosity with moderate staining of the tears and loads of fine sediment. On the nose, the wine is vinous with notes of mostly dried, desiccated fruit: cherries, blackberries, leather, cocoa, earth and warm spices. On the palate, the wine is dry with medium, integrated tannins and medium+ acid. Confirming the notes from the nose plus the addition of an umami note that’s quite attractive. The finish is medium+ and slightly savory. Drink now. — 7 months ago
